由于在nginx配置中,设置了limit_req的流量限制,导致许多请求返回503错误代码,在限流的条件下,为提高用户体验,希望返回正常Code 200,且返回操作频繁的信息:

location  /test {... limit_req zone=zone_ip_rm burst=1 nodelay; error_page 503 =200 /dealwith_503?callback=$arg_callback;
}
location /dealwith_503{ set $ret_body '{"code": "V00006","msg": "操作太频繁了,请坐下来喝杯茶。"}';if ( $arg_callback != "" ) { return 200 'try{$arg_callback($ret_body)}catch(e){}'; } return 200 $ret_body;
}

Nginx HTTP返回状态码修改相关推荐

  1. nginx 返回状态码详解

    nginx 返回状态码详解 200 (成功) 服务器已成功处理了请求. 通常,这表示服务器提供了请求的网页. 201 (已创建) 请求成功并且服务器创建了新的资源. 202 (已接受) 服务器已接受请 ...

  2. Nginx code 常用状态码学习小结

    最近了解下Nginx的Code状态码,在此简单总结下.一个http请求处理流程: 一个普通的http请求处理流程,如上图所示: A -> client端发起请求给nginx B -> ng ...

  3. python-网页请求返回状态码429

    在做读取本地cookies免登陆直接留言时,代码没有报错,但返回状态码为429,返回结果为:<Response [429]> 表示在短时间内,用户发送了太多的请求,超出了"频次限 ...

  4. 常见服务器返回状态码

    常见服务器返回状态码 输入网址后会发生什么 1. 200 服务器正确处理请求,并将请求的资源放在响应体中返回给客户. 2. 204 若服务器拒绝对PUT.POST或者DELETE请求返回任何状态信息或 ...

  5. 返回状态码304 Not Modified详解

    第一次访问 200 鼠标点击二次访问 (Cache) 按F5刷新 304 按Ctrl+F5强制刷新 200 在客户端向服务端发送http请求时,若返回状态码为304 Not Modified 则表明此 ...

  6. 【Nginx】警惕状态码 499 ,不只是 504

    目录 [Nginx]警惕状态码 499 ,不只是 504 状态码含义 499也危险 [Nginx]警惕状态码 499 ,不只是 504 状态码含义 499 499, Client Closed Req ...

  7. 页面HTTP状态查询“返回状态码:200 ”是什么意思?(网页响应状态码)

    200是响应正常的意思,这个是服务器返回页面的响应头信息.里面bai的Transfer-Encoding: chunked,意思是使用了提前不可知数据长度的传输方式,需要浏览器继续读取响应,接下来才知 ...

  8. 【操作消息提醒——AjaxResult】和【返回状态码——HttpStatus】

    文章目录 1.操作消息提醒--AjaxResult.java 2.返回状态码--HttpStatus 1.操作消息提醒--AjaxResult.java package com.shuang.mess ...

  9. 打开网站服务器显示403,网站服务器返回状态码403解决办法

    网站服务器返回状态码403解决办法 [2020-09-05 06:10:52]  简介: HTTP状态码大全 2020-08-27 建站服务器 200 – 服务器成功返回网页 404 – 请求的网页不 ...

最新文章

  1. java的算法库_java – 如何实现算法库?
  2. 如何学习网络协议(学习笔记)
  3. 复现经典:《统计学习方法》第14章 聚类方法
  4. AI研究公司面试准备指南
  5. webdynpro 组件重用 传值问题
  6. 2016年世界编程大赛_2016年热门编程趋势
  7. Linux设备驱动模型-Uevent
  8. 简化企业CMMI5认证过程?
  9. FLTK--轻量级C++跨平台GUI库
  10. 最新勒索软件WannaCrypt病毒感染前后应对措施
  11. 月份/星期表(缩写)
  12. 第三章直接耦合多级放大电路
  13. 又一个充电宝改装,经验升级版。
  14. 基于Paddle复现《Neighbor2Neighbor: Self-Supervised Denoising from Single Noisy Images》降噪网络
  15. php每日答题,持续更新!每日答题汇总
  16. 计算机毕业设计(70)php小程序毕设作品之干洗店洗衣小程序系统
  17. DMA+ADC快速采集直流无刷电机电流
  18. Photoshop CC 2020软件安装教程 + 学习技巧
  19. 广外2023口译(非英专)复习资料以及模考反馈
  20. ARM处理器中断处理机制

热门文章

  1. 美团简单版动态线程池源码实现
  2. Stable Diffusion的原理
  3. idea设置中文版(详细)
  4. html制作学生证表格,学生证表格模板.pdf
  5. godoc安装与go文档查询
  6. 消息中间件解析 | 如何正确理解软件应用系统中关于系统通信的那些事?
  7. Android之monkey Test,Monkey测试中的黑名单和白名单,Monkey测试中的黑名单和白名单
  8. 如何结合均线分析伦敦金行情走势线图
  9. 王者荣耀s22服务器维修,王者荣耀资源包升级失败 S22资源包升级失败解决方法...
  10. R语言与Markov Chain Monte Carlo(MCMC)方法学习笔记(2)